Product description
This HDPE pipe from Al Mona Factory is engineered for reliable irrigation and water conveyance in Qatar's demanding environment. Manufactured from high-density polyethylene (PE 63) to DIN 8074/8075 standards, it delivers exceptional strength and flexibility, making it ideal for both underground and above-ground installations across Doha, Al Rayyan, and Al Wakrah.
With a nominal pressure rating of 15.9 bar and a standard dimensional ratio (SDR) of 7.4, this pipe withstands high operating pressures, ensuring consistent water flow for agricultural and municipal projects. Its robust construction offers superior resistance to impact, abrasion, and external factors, while its smooth interior minimizes friction losses and energy consumption.
Designed for a maintenance-free service life of over 50 years, this pipe is a cost-effective solution for long-term infrastructure. The black color provides UV protection, making it suitable for exposed installations under the intense Qatari sun.
Key Specifications
- Outside diameter: 450 mm
- Wall thickness: 61.5 mm
- Weight: 74.4 kg/m
- Standard dimensional ratio: SDR 7.4
- Nominal pressure: 15.9 bar
- Pipe series (S): 3.2
- Material grade: PE 63
- Color: Black
- Minimum required strength (MRS): 6.3 MPa
- Design stress (ฯs): 5.04 MPa
- Design safety factor: C=1.25
- Length: 12 meters (custom lengths available on request)
- Manufactured according to: DIN 8074/8075
